Compact Machine vs. Bobcat for Land Clearing

When tackling a property preparation project, the choice between a small digger and a Bobcat often poses a challenge. Usually, a small digger excels at handling tougher obstacles , like roots , and digging deep material . They offer greater digging depth and precision , particularly beneficial for difficult terrain. Conversely, a Bobcat is more preferred for broad removal tasks, transferring large volumes of materials and working on relatively even surfaces. In conclusion, the ideal machinery depends on the particular type of removal required .

Land Clearing Costs: What to Expect & How to Save

Preparing the acreage of terrain for development can be surprisingly costly . Land clearing charges vary significantly depending on quite a few factors, like the thickness of vegetation , the incline of the soil, and accessibility for equipment . You may expect to pay anywhere from approximately $2 to $10 each square area for basic clearing , but that figure can readily increase if trees need removal , or if boulders are present .

In the end , careful planning and shopping can help you to manage your land clearing outlay.

Clearing Land: Essential Steps & Equipment Choices

Preparing a parcel of land for use often involves land clearing, a substantial undertaking requiring thorough planning and the right tools. The initial process is a complete evaluation of the site, identifying impediments such as vegetation, rocks, and underbrush. Next, you must secure licenses from local departments, ensuring compliance with environmental laws. Choosing tools is important; options include a heavy loader for major elimination, a chipper for minor vegetation, a power saw for individual trees, and a scoop attachment for moving debris. Furthermore, consider the secureness of your crew and the nearby landscape throughout the complete procedure.

How to Clear ground Effectively with a skid steer

Clearing brush from a lot can be a significant undertaking, but a bobcat can drastically reduce the work involved. First, ensure you have the right attachments for the job; a forestry cutter is ideal for heavy vegetation, while a grapple is excellent for gathering timber and debris. Thoroughly plan your approach, starting with the largest obstacles, like fallen trees. Patiently move across the area, using the skid steer’s maneuverability to manage uneven terrain. Remember to constantly check for underground utilities before breaking ground and wear safety gear at all times.
